Hey all, a friend of mine has a '99 Altima. He was telling me that whenever he slows down or brakes, the car makes a groaning type sound up front. He said it sounded like it was coming from some part of the suspension, but didn't know which part. He did say it wasn't the squealing of worn brake pads or the clicking of cv joints. I haven't been in the car, so unfortunately I can't be more specific, but hopefully I can get some possible ideas of what is wrong with it to help him out. Thanks in advance.

Without more info I would raise the front wheels off of the ground by using strudy jack stands and then crank the car and out it in drive and then apply the brakes. This way he can see just where the noise is coming from, I suspect the front drive assembly. I assume he has standard size tires on it and this is not a tire rubbing noise.
